Samuel Norrby
Samuel Norrby (13 November 1906 โ 28 November 1955) was a Swedish shot putter who won five consecutive Swedish titles in 1930โ34. He competed in the 1934 European Championships and placed fourth, 9 cm behind the bronze medal. In the 1950s Norrby held leading positions in the Swedish Athletics Association and was a member of parliament.[2]
